Rains Helping
I County Wheat
Smith Declares
1 1
Payne county wheat grOwers
have been aided materially by the 1
recent rain I
"Both ranchers who use wheat
for winter pasture and farmers !
who grow wheat for a cash crop i
have been helped by the rain"
Lester Smith Payne county agent
said today
It iS presently in the two three
anti four kat stage however
growth has slowed becate4 et the
lower temperatures Smith said
Fall oats and barley have not
Lured as well but oats seem to
be in better condition than barley
according to Smith
"Some of the less hardy va-
rieties of barley were hard hit la
sections north of Payne county by
' freezing weather last month'
Smith said "and some Payne
county farmers have said they
were hiut by the coli"
- Dryness and frectiog have
slowed the growth of three crops
but ' bece of the rain ranchers
i aus
and farmers should have a good i
crop Smith added !! I
